The Impact of Indoor Moisture Levels on Human Comfort
The amount of moisture in the air is what we call humidity. The presence of high humidity levels causes the air to feel warmer which triggers uncomfortable experiences for users and leads to both sweat retention and respiratory disturbances. The second side of this is when humidity levels become too low they produce dry skin and cause respiratory system irritation.
The goal for modern air conditioning systems is to maintain indoor moisture content levels within a 30% to 50% range which represents the preferred zone for improved comfort conditions and health benefits.
The Role of Modern ACs in Humidity Control
Today’s AC systems feature special moisture monitoring and regulation features along with modern cooling capabilities in contrast to older models that only worked to reduce temperature levels. Here are some of the most effective ways they help:
1. Advanced Dehumidification Modes
Modern air conditioning units usually include a separate Dry Mode which decreases humidity levels but stays gentle on room temperature. The system operates with its fan at reduced speed and slow compressor cycling to withdraw extra moisture from the environment. The feature is especially valuable in monsoon time and in coastal regions which experience high humidity conditions.
2. Inverter Technology for Balanced Humidity
Inverter air conditioners provide essential support to achieve constant humidity levels. The inverter compressor continues to run without stopping by changing its speed throughout operation. The continuously running system maintains optimal moisture amounts while eliminating abrupt humidity variations. Through accurate climate management inverter technology cuts down energy usage and delivers maximum premium comfort.

4. Smart Sensors and Climate Monitoring
Premium AC models now include humidity sensors that track indoor moisture levels throughout the day. Fans and cooling intensity modify themselves automatically in response to sensor readings in order to maintain ideal humidity levels. Through app connectivity smart ACs give users the ability to remotely monitor and control indoor humidity levels.
